    Why IOSH Leading Safely?

    The IOSH Leading Safely course is designed specifically for anyone in a senior management or leadership role.

    Organisation leaders and directors don't need to be experts on health and safety, but they do need to understand the importance of health and safety and learn the true value of good health and safety practices.

    It is often unrealistic to expect leaders within an organisation to have the time to attend long courses on health and safety, so IOSH has introduced the IOSH Leading Safely course to give delegates the knowledge they need to sharpen their skills and be effective leaders.
    Using your organisation's current health and safety policies and practices, this course gives leaders the skills to develop their future health and safety vision in line with best practise models of safety.     Course Content

    The course content can be tailored to your organisation and industry, you'll go through relevant case studies and benchmark your health and safety policies and procedures against others in your sector.

    IOSH Leading Safely Content

    • Recognising the value of strategic safety and health and its integration into business management systems and performance management systems
    • Understanding your safety and health responsibilities
    • Appreciating the consequences of poor safety and health
    • Planning the overall direction for safety and health in your organisation
    • Understanding the importance of adequately resourcing your safety and health management system
    • Knowing why you should monitor and review your safety and health performance

    IOSH Leading Safely Course Structure

    • 1 day (5 hours)
    • Short pre course material online
    • Support before, during and after the course through the IOSH course app
    • Relevant case studies

    Assessment

    Learners use the diagnostic tool, accessed via a mobile app, to identify their current safety and health position against a set of critical questions. The tool recommends the actions they should take. At the end of the course they make a commitment to a personal action plan to improve their own and their organisations’ safety and health management.

    Prerequisites

    There aren't any entry requirements to take the IOSH Leading Safely course, but it has been designed for organisation leaders and directors.

      Maximum delegates on an IOSH course?

      IOSH allow a maximum of 20 delegates per course, however, to get the most out of training we recommend having no more than 12 delegates. If you would like a group trained we can accommodate any group size up to 20.
